What Is IPTV?
IPTV is a digital television system that uses internet protocols to deliver video content. Unlike traditional broadcasting methods, IPTV streams media directly over broadband internet connections.
Traditional television relies on:
- Satellite dishes
- Cable lines
- Antennas
IPTV works differently because all content is delivered online in real time.
This means users can stream:
- Live TV channels
- Movies
- TV series
- Sports events
- Video-on-demand content
One of the biggest advantages of IPTV is flexibility. Users can watch content on multiple devices without needing large satellite installations or expensive cable equipment.
How IPTV Works
Understanding how IPTV works helps beginners choose the right setup and streaming devices.
Internet-Based Streaming Technology
IPTV sends television content through internet data packets instead of traditional broadcasting signals.
When a user selects a channel or movie:
- The IPTV server receives the request
- The content is processed
- The stream is delivered instantly to the device
This creates smooth online streaming without needing satellite infrastructure.
Recent streaming industry research confirms that internet-based TV consumption continues replacing traditional broadcast methods globally.
IPTV Servers and Content Delivery
IPTV providers operate servers that distribute media streams to subscribers.
These servers manage:
- Live channel broadcasting
- Video-on-demand libraries
- Catch-up TV services
- Electronic program guides
Good IPTV providers use powerful servers and CDN systems to reduce buffering and improve streaming stability.

Getting IPTV Login Details
After purchasing a subscription, IPTV providers usually send:
- M3U playlist URLs
- Xtream Codes login credentials
- EPG guide links
Users enter these details into IPTV apps to access content.

Internet Requirements for IPTV
A stable internet connection is essential for IPTV streaming.
Streaming QualityRecommended SpeedSD Streaming10 MbpsHD Streaming25 Mbps4K Streaming50 Mbps
Ethernet connections often provide better stability than Wi-Fi for IPTV streaming.

Common IPTV Problems and Solutions
Even good IPTV services can sometimes experience issues.
Buffering Problems
Causes include:
- Slow internet
- Weak Wi-Fi
- Overloaded servers
Solutions:
- Use Ethernet
- Upgrade internet speed
- Restart router
App Freezing
Updating IPTV apps regularly often fixes freezing issues.
Playlist Errors
Incorrect login details may prevent playlist loading.
Always verify credentials carefully.
